Laptop battery won't charge.
I have a PCG-K13 Sony Vaio Laptop that is just over a year old and rarely used. My original power adapter died on me so I bought a replacement universal adapter. It's a Targus model # ac70u adapter. It works fine for powering the computer up but the battery on my laptop does not charge. The little icon comes up on the bottom right corner saying it is charging but it never goes above 0%. Once I disconnect the power cord the computer shuts off so I know the battery is not getting any juice. Would this most likely be caused because it's not the origonal power cord or maybe just a dead battery? Anyone have any ideas?
